The impact of the Food Security Act 1985 and the implications for 1990 food and agricultural legislation are discussed. The main factors in the policy-making process are identified and the process of compromise in policy-setting described. Those interested in the price and quality of farm programme commodities are producers, input suppliers, output handlers, users and processors, consumers, food aid advocates, and taxpayers.
